Scott Fraser Pollock 1902–1984 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 01 May 1902
Birth Location: Glen Levit, Restigouche County, New Brunswick, Canada
Death Date: 31 Jan 1984
Death Location: Gibsons, Sunshine Coast Regional District, British Columbia, Canada
Father: Simon Pollock
Mother: Ellen Bain
Spouse(s): Maria Meeley
Children(s):
In 1902, Scott Fraser Pollock entered the world in Glen Levit, Restigouche County, New Brunswick, Canada, born to Simon Fraser Pollock And Ellen Ann Nellie Bain. In 1921, Scott Fraser Pollock resided in Addington, Parish of Addington, Restigouche and Ma. Scott Fraser Pollock married Maria Eleanor Elsie Meeley. Scott Fraser Pollock passed away in 1984 in Gibsons, Sunshine Coast Regional District, British Columbia, Canada.
